Innovations in Robotics



One significant advancement in oral surgery is the use of robot technology, which permits exact and reliable surgeries. With the help of robotic systems, oral doctors have the ability to do complex surgical procedures with improved accuracy, reducing the risk of human error.



These robot systems are geared up with sophisticated imaging modern technology and precise tools that make it possible for specialists to browse via intricate physiological frameworks effortlessly. By utilizing robotic innovation, cosmetic surgeons can attain higher surgical precision, causing improved person results and faster recovery times.

In addition, the use of robotics in oral surgery allows for minimally invasive procedures, lowering the trauma to bordering cells and advertising faster healing.

Minimally Invasive Strategies



To better advance the area of oral surgery, welcome the possibility of minimally intrusive strategies that can substantially benefit both doctors and individuals alike.

Minimally invasive strategies are revolutionizing the area by lowering surgical trauma, decreasing post-operative pain, and speeding up the healing procedure. These methods include making use of smaller lacerations and specialized tools to carry out procedures with accuracy and efficiency.

By utilizing sophisticated imaging modern technology, such as cone beam calculated tomography (CBCT), specialists can precisely plan and perform surgeries with minimal invasiveness.

In addition, the use of lasers in dental surgery enables accurate cells cutting and coagulation, causing reduced blood loss and minimized recovery time.

With minimally intrusive techniques, patients can experience quicker healing, lowered scarring, and boosted end results, making it a crucial facet of the future of dental surgery.
